Holiday Hills Police Dept

Holiday Hills Police Dept is a company Located at Mchenry,Illinois,United States with a telephone number 8153852828, (815)385-2828.Provided Justice, Public Order and Safety products and service.
Contact Info
Map
Map of Holiday Hills Police Dept, address:,Mchenry,Illinois,United States.